Studio Electronics MIDI Moog Minimoog Oscillator Board


via this auction

"Studio Electronics oscillator circuit board from their MIDIMini rackmount Minimoog synthesizer. This is 3 cloned Minimoog oscillators on a circuitboard. It's a more stable version of the original Minimoog oscillator board that can plug directly into either a Studio Electronics MIDI Mini or a real vintage Minimoog model D synthesizer. It's the same shape and size of the original Minimoog oscillator board. If you have an original Minimoog but it's got dead oscillators or really unstable oscillators, this board may be a good purchase for you. Alternatively, if you're a DIY type who enjoys building synths, you might want to buy this board so you've got 3 Minimoog style oscillators at your disposal. Obviously there's no power supply or chassis included so if you're without a vintage Minimoog or MIDImini, you'll need to rig something up."

Crumar Stratus

images at this auction
"We've had multiples of most vintage synths but this is the first one of these we've had in. So either they're rare or there just arent many of them here in the US. The color scheme reminds us of the Oberheim OBX. Here's an overview.... It's a 2 oscillator 6 note polyphonic analog synth that uses CEM chips, the same type inside the most sought after vintage analog polysynths, so there's a similar sound, perhaps with a lesser price tag. There's also an organ section with 4 drawbars to determine volumes of each of 4 octaves. The filter sounds really nice - its got quite a warm sound. The LFO can do FM, wah or tremolo. The LFO section also has adjustable slope and delay, which many similar synths didn't have. There's a button that causes the LFO to automatically do 1 octave square wave pitch modulation, which is a really interesting feature. The oscillator glide can be set to single or multi trigger. There's an oscillator pitch envelope as well. Otherwise, it's got your usual polysynth features. One particular strange feature is the ability for the voices to alternate between square and sawtooth waveforms. I can understand both at the same time, but alternating?
